Q: Is 257,628 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 257,628 is a composite number.

Why is 257,628 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 257,628 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 7 12 14 21 28 42 84 3,067 6,134 9,201 12,268 18,402 21,469 36,804 42,938 64,407 85,876 128,814 and 257,628, with no remainder.

Since 257,628 cannot be divided by just 1 and 257,628, it is a composite number.
